I am giving you name of short term job oriented course after completing B.Com below :
Diploma in banking and insurance
Diploma in financial management
Diploma in retail management
Diploma in risk management
Short term courses of NSDLand CDSL
Course on capital market
English speaking course
NIIT course
Tally
DCA
Data entry jobs
Footwear designing course
Fashion designing
Other courses
CA course
ICWA course
M.Com
MBA course

Management Aptitude Test (MAT) is a standardised test being administered by AIMA since 1988 to facilitate Business Schools (B-Schools) to screen candidates for admission to MBA and allied programmes. Govt. of India, Ministry of HRD approved MAT as a national level test in 2003. Graduates in any discipline is eligible to appear in MAT, Final year students of Graduate Courses can also apply for MAT. Majority of BSchools using MAT score has min 50% marks is graduation degree as eligibility criteria.
